a circuit board containing electrical wiring;
a first LED subunit;
a second LED sub-unit disposed on the first LED sub-unit;
a third LED sub-unit disposed on the second LED sub-unit;
a passivation layer disposed over the third LED unit;
a first connection electrode electrically connected to at least one of the first, second and third LED subunits;
including
wherein said first connecting electrode and said third LED subunit form a first angle of about 80° or less, defined between the top surface of said third LED subunit and the inner surface of said first connecting electrode; panel .
